DAY 6 Lake Nakuru to Lake Naivasha

After an early breakfast, the drive continues to Kenya’s highest lake, at 1,880 meters above sea level, Lake Naivasha. Lake Naivasha is a beautiful freshwater lake, fringed by thick papyrus. You will observe Hippos lazing in the lake and Buffalos grazing on the shores during your boat ride. There are over 300 species of birds to observe. These include the Grey-capped Warbler, Spectacled Weaver, Brimstone Canary, and the Red-billed fire finch. Lunch will be served at Fishermen Camp or similar. In the afternoon there are boat trips on the lake or nature walks on crescent Island. You will have the chance to see some of the animals at very close range e.g. Zebras, Giraffes and Wildebeest. DAY 7 Nairobi Excursion - Airport Drop-Off

After breakfast, we drive to the Giraffe Centre where you feed Rothschild giraffes under the supervision of keepers. The centre has rescued, hand-reared and released giraffes back into the wild. This attraction offers opportunities to feed the endangered Rothschild's giraffe by hand. The location also offers a fine education on the physiology, behaviours preferences of these beautiful animals. Afterwards, a drive to the elephant orphanage the David Sheldrick Wildlife Trust elephant offers a wonderful opportunity to meet staff caring for baby elephants, and sometimes baby rhinos, which have been orphaned. Each keeper gives a short presentation to the visitors nearest to him, explaining how orphaned elephants need to be cared for.
